Searched refs:gisc (Results 1 - 6 of 6) sorted by relevance

/linux-master/arch/s390/kvm/
H A Dpci.h29 u8 gisc; member in struct:zpci_gaite
H A Dpci.c233 int rc = 0, gisc, npages, pcount = 0; local
246 gisc = kvm_s390_gisc_register(kvm, fib->fmt0.isc);
247 if (gisc < 0)
248 return gisc;
304 gaite->gisc = fib->fmt0.isc;
315 fib->fmt0.isc = gisc;
364 isc = gaite->gisc;
373 gaite->gisc = 0;
H A Dinterrupt.c306 static inline void gisa_set_ipm_gisc(struct kvm_s390_gisa *gisa, u32 gisc) argument
308 set_bit_inv(IPM_BIT_OFFSET + gisc, (unsigned long *) gisa);
316 static inline int gisa_tac_ipm_gisc(struct kvm_s390_gisa *gisa, u32 gisc) argument
318 return test_and_clear_bit_inv(IPM_BIT_OFFSET + gisc, (unsigned long *) gisa);
3247 * @gisc: the guest interruption sub class to register
3260 int kvm_s390_gisc_register(struct kvm *kvm, u32 gisc) argument
3266 if (gisc > MAX_ISC)
3270 gi->alert.ref_count[gisc]++;
3271 if (gi->alert.ref_count[gisc] == 1) {
3272 gi->alert.mask |= 0x80 >> gisc;
3299 kvm_s390_gisc_unregister(struct kvm *kvm, u32 gisc) argument
[all...]
/linux-master/arch/s390/include/asm/
H A Dap.h280 unsigned int gisc : 3; /* guest isc field */ member in struct:ap_tapq_hwinfo::__anon27::__anon29::ap_qirq_ctrl::__anon31
H A Dkvm_host.h1044 extern int kvm_s390_gisc_register(struct kvm *kvm, u32 gisc);
1045 extern int kvm_s390_gisc_unregister(struct kvm *kvm, u32 gisc);
/linux-master/drivers/s390/crypto/
H A Dvfio_ap_ops.c446 aqic_gisa.gisc = isc;
458 VFIO_AP_DBF_WARN("%s: gisc registration failed: nisc=%d, isc=%d, apqn=%#04x\n",
495 "zone=%#x, ir=%#x, gisc=%#x, f=%#x,"
498 aqic_gisa.zone, aqic_gisa.ir, aqic_gisa.gisc,

Completed in 165 milliseconds